How to Choose an Online Slot

Online slot is a popular casino game where you put in money, spin the reels and hope that you land winning combinations. These games can offer big payouts but they also require complex technology to run them. Luckily, there are many different types of online slots to choose from and the technology behind them is constantly evolving to make them more exciting and rewarding for players.

The first thing to look for when choosing an online slot is security and legitimacy. There are a lot of rogue casinos out there, so be sure to check that a casino is licensed and secure before you deposit any money. You should also check the Return to Player rate and variance (how often a slot pays out) on the casino website. These will give you an idea of how much you can expect to win from a given game.

Next, you need to consider the number of paylines and bonus features in an online slot. The number of paylines can vary from one to dozens, while bonus features can include scatters, wilds and other symbols that increase your chances of winning. Some of these features are available at all online slot machines, but others are unique to specific games. For instance, the Wild symbol in a slot can substitute for other symbols to form winning combinations.

Another factor to consider when choosing an online slot is whether it offers a progressive jackpot or a fixed jackpot. A progressive jackpot will continue to rise until a lucky player wins it. This type of jackpot is common in video slots and is often larger than a traditional jackpot.

There are hundreds of developers who produce online slots. However, some of the biggest names in the industry are Microgaming, Play’n GO, NetEnt and Yggdrasil. These companies are known for creating games that are popular with players around the world. You can find their games at most major online casinos.

Most online slot games have a theme, such as fruit, mystery, games based on TV shows or animals. Some of them are branded and feature the logos of famous movies, sports teams, music bands or other entities. These branded slots are usually developed through licensing agreements.
